Threat intelligence refers to the analysis of data concerning potential cyber threats. This intelligence helps organizations prepare for and mitigate risks associated with cyber attacks.
Incorporating threat intelligence into cybersecurity strategies enhances an organization’s ability to respond to incidents effectively and proactively.
Organizations can implement threat intelligence through:
Collecting threat data from various sources, including threat feeds and cybersecurity reports, provides a comprehensive view of potential risks.
Regular analysis and sharing of threat intelligence within teams can improve readiness and response strategies to emerging threats.
Integrating threat intelligence into cybersecurity practices is essential for organizations to stay ahead of cybercriminals. By understanding and leveraging threat data, businesses can enhance their security measures and protect sensitive information effectively.
